My wife had been at Autumn Leaves for over 2 years. I recently moved her. On the positive, the office, marketing, and activities staff have been at Autumn Leaves for a long time and are good. The health director is new but in my limited experience is excellent and cares. I hope she stays. The caregivers and nursing staff as a whole care and really try. Management is taking new residents with significant behavioral / health issues and that with the normal deteriation of mental / health of long-term residents, in my opinion, combines to seriously overburden the caregivers which are staffed at the minimum levels required by the State of Oklahoma for an assisted living facility. The problem is that many of the residents need a lot more help that is normally required in a regular assisted living facility. The result is very high turnover and 'call ins / no shows' of caregivers and nursing staff in an industry known for its high turnover to begin with. This result in the community is turmoil, confusion, inconsistent care, and sometimes inadequate care especially where personalized care is needed. I lbelieve the problem is not enough staff to adequately care for the number of residents with their behavioral / health issues that are present at Autumn Leaves. Management will tell you Autumn Leaves is adequately staffed. I would recommend they take the place of a caregiver for a week and then tell me Autumn Leaves is adequately staffed. At first Autumn Leaves was good. In January 2014 it was told to us that [removed]. Management handled the situation poorly and in my opinion Autumn Leaves has been in a state of turmoil and decline since. [removed]. I left as soon as I could make other arrangements for my wife. I had been unhappy with the care and had concern for the safety of my wife and should have left a long time ago. Autumn Leaves might be a facility to consider if: 1) Your loved one has significant behavoral / health problems in addition to dementia. 2) You don't mind paying a good price for at best fair care. Autumn Leaves uses the slogan; "Our family taking care of your family." It may have started as a family endeavor but it is now a corporation with many facilities across the country. Based on my experience with Autumn Leaves in Tulsa, I would change the slogan to say; "Our corporation making sure we and management are taken care of." Be aware.

Mom has Alzheimer's. The Director of Sales (not sure if that title is correct) was new at the time, and she assured us that they were qualified to care for Alzheimer's residents, and there were activities throughout the day that they could involve her in. Five days after Mom moved in, we got a call from the Director of Admissions saying they were not qualified to care for Alzheimer's residents and we had two weeks to move her to a different facility. They did not involve her in activities throut the day, and one nurse even told us that Mom just stayed by the front door all day. After we moved Mom, we requested a refund from Heritage Village for the balance of the month. By then there was also a new Director of Admissions. We were told we had to contact the national office. Finally, six months later, we got our refund. Because there was so much turnover in staff, we did not have a good experience with Heritage Village. I hope they have improved since then. The only other thing I can think of to add is that while Mom was there, they had to treat the room next to her for bedbugs, but I know from my interviews with other facilities that bedbugs could show up at any facility.
